Studio XAG creates fixtures for Coach pop-up using discarded leather scraps
A colourful, reconstituted leather made from cutting room scraps was among the recycled materials used to create the fixtures and fittings for Coachtopia, a London pop-up store for American label Coach.
Located in the Wonder Room at Selfridges in London, the temporary store was created to launch a new collection of Coach products crafted from reused leather bags and recycled materials.
Called Coachtopia, the collection seeks to challenge fashion's linear system where most products end up in landfill.
Coachtopia was located in department store Selfridges' Wonder Room
Each of the products in the Coachtopia collection has a clear pathway for reuse and recycling, according to the brand, and comes with an embedded NFC chip that tracks its lifecycle. Chosen by Coach for its sustainable approach and B Corp-certified status, retail experience agency Studio XAG was commissioned to create a temporary store space to launch the product line.
The resulting space, which features a modular display system made of recyclable parts that slot together, has been shortlisted in the retail interior (small) category of Dezeen Awards 2023.
It features display counters made from reconstituted leather
"The Coachtopia product line is designed to be 'circular from the start' ? considering the future life of a product proactively, rather than reactively," Studio XAG said.
"We mirrored Coach's circular ethos for the collection through three approaches to the physical space."
